摘要: |
D-STATCOM的控制方法直接影响其补偿精度、开关频率和功率损耗。为保证D-STATCOM具有较高的补偿精度并降低开关频率,提出了结合空间矢量法的滞环电流控制新方法。通过滞环电流控制法与空间矢量法结合,将D-STATCOM跟踪误差进行分区域处理,针对不同大小的跟踪误差采用不同的控制方法降低开关频率。同时,考虑到采用不同控制方法时D-STATCOM具有不同的补偿延时,对电流误差限值的确定方法进行了分析。仿真和试验样机表明,该方法能有效降低D-STATCOM开关频率且具有较高的补偿精度,证明了方法的正确性和可行性。 |
关键词: 配电网静止无功发生器 三相四桥臂 滞环电流控制 空间矢量滞环控制 开关频率 |

Abstract: |
The control strategy of D-STATCOM directly influence its compensation accuracy, switch frequency and power loss. A novel control strategy is proposed to reduce the switch frequency on the assurance of its compensation accuracy. Combining hysteresis current control method with SVPWM, the control strategy proposes that different current size uses different control method to realize fast track and low switch frequency; at the same time, the determination of current error threshold method is analyzed considering different control strategy has different compensation delay for D-STATCOM. Simulation and experiment show this method can reduce switch frequency efficiently and high compensation accuracy, so the correctness and feasibility of the proposed method is proved. |
